About my charity : International Childcare Trust International Childcare Trust
International Childcare Trust works in the UK and in developing countries, in direct partnership with local groups, to implement innovative and cost-effective development and relief initiatives for the poorest members of the community.

I have completed the Cycle Kenya Challenge 2008 and it was really, really hard!  It was the hardest ride ever, which made the fact that the team did such a great job spectacular!

Giving to ICT has always meant giving to a good cause, but it just keeps getting better!  In 2006/07, we were able to more than double the amount of funding we sent to the programmes we support with displaced children Africa and Asia.  The beauty of the donations that you guys make is that they are unrestricted, so they free us from grant dependency and almost all of the funding we raised through your contributions last year were allocated to initiating new work with new partners, so you guys are also helping us to innovate and grow!  Our ability to support new projects, particularly with children who have been displaced by AIDS, in East Africa, is down to you guys!
